中等
技术面试0 次浏览

米哈游的游戏经常更新新内容,在设计可扩展性强的UI系统时,你会考虑哪些因素?如何确保新内容能够无缝融入现有界面?

米哈游UI/UX 设计师
可扩展性UI系统游戏更新新内容融入

答题要点

推荐答题框架:分层分析法,从架构设计、模块划分、数据管理等方面进行分析。关键要点如下:1. 架构设计:采用模块化、组件化的设计思想,将UI系统拆分成多个独立的模块,方便后续扩展。2. 模块划分:合理划分功能模块,确保每个模块具有明确的职责和接口,便于新内容的添加。3. 数据管理:设计灵活的数据结构,能够适应不同类型的新内容,同时保证数据的一致性和可维护性。4. 兼容性测试:在添加新内容后,进行全面的兼容性测试,确保新内容与现有界面的无缝融合。示例话术:在设计可扩展性强的UI系统时,我会首先采用模块化架构,将不同功能拆分成独立的模块。然后,合理划分模块,明确每个模块的职责。在数据管理方面,我会设计灵活的数据结构,方便新内容的存储和展示。最后,在添加新内容后,进行严格的兼容性测试,确保新内容能够完美融入现有界面。